## Deploying the Gatewick Proctor Queue

Deploys are pretty painless: push to main, wait for the pipeline, then watch the queue drain dashboard for five minutes. If candidates pile up mid-exam, roll back first and ask questions later — the queue replays safely. Everything the workers care about lives in one config block, shown here for reference.

settings of bafof-yagef:
JOROX_PIN=8740
JOROX_TENANT=pelox
JOROX_METRICS_HOST=metrics.jorox.qorvelworks.internal
JOROX_SEAL=seal_c78f63c1
JOROX_STANDBY_TEAM=norax

Ticket #—Facilities: Temporary site setup during Kestrel House renovation. Hi all, while level 3 is being gutted, the team assistants' pool moves to the Portway Annex across the courtyard. Printers and the stationery cupboard are already there; couriers should be redirected to the annex loading bay. It's a bit of a maze, so allow extra time on day one. The annex side door stays locked at all times, so you'll need the temporary pass code below.

badge for kagag-fajof: bdg-ZEO-7

Internal Memo — Q2 Cash-Flow Forecast

Branch managers, a heads-up on the quarterly numbers. Cash flow at Morvale Trading is tracking slightly ahead of forecast, mainly thanks to faster collections in the Ashbourne and Kettlewick branches — nice work. That said, we're keeping discretionary spend tight through July while the Pellion rollout absorbs working capital. Expect updated branch targets from Doran's team next week. To understand why we're being cautious, please read the confidential note appended below.

confidential, kagep-kahof: Druokax Systems plans to lower the Ulaath list price by 53 percent in March.

## Resolver Batching Fix

The Quillgate API previously issued one database query per node when resolving `member.permissions`, producing an N+1 pattern that an attacker could amplify with deeply nested queries. We now batch permission lookups through a DataLoader layer with a bounded cache keyed per request. From a security standpoint, the batch window also acts as a soft rate limiter, since oversized queries are coalesced and capped before reaching the datastore. The loader's behavior is governed by the constants below.

tuning table, yajog-yahof:
BUDGETS = {
    "lamvan": 303,
    "wenox": 460,
    "fenvan": 525,
}